The Historical Context of Gambling and Risk-Taking

Gambling, in its myriad forms, has a long and complex history, stretching back to ancient civilizations. Evidence suggests that dice games were popular in ancient Egypt, and gambling dens flourished in ancient Rome. Across cultures, games of chance have often been intertwined with religious ceremonies, social gatherings, and even political maneuvering. This historical context demonstrates that the impulse to take risks for potential reward is deeply ingrained in the human psyche. The cultural acceptance or rejection of gambling has varied considerably over time and place, often influenced by moral, religious, and economic factors. Understanding these historical nuances is crucial to appreciating how modern platforms, like those offering access to experiences akin to that of rizk, have evolved to address contemporary sensibilities and regulations.

The Influence of Regulation and Responsible Gambling

The online casino industry is subject to increasingly stringent regulation, designed to protect players, prevent money laundering, and ensure fair gaming practices. Reg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ority and the UK Gambling Commission, impose strict licensing requirements and ongoing oversight to maintain industry standards. This regulation is crucial for building trust and credibility in the industry, as it demonstrates a commitment to responsible gambling and player protection. Responsible gambling initiatives, such as self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and reality checks, are essential for helping players to stay in control of their gambling habits. Platforms like Rizk have a responsibility to promote responsible gambling and provide players with the tools and resources they need to make informed decisions.

The future of online gambling will likely see even greater emphasis on regulation and responsible gambling practices. Advancements in technology, such as artificial intelligence and machine learning, will enable regulators to better detect and prevent fraudulent activity, as well as identify players who may be at risk of developing gambling problems. Collaborations between industry stakeholders, regulators, and responsible gambling organizations will be critical for creating a sustainable and ethical online gambling environment.
